 Freeman's English language questions thread
Does "nice try" actually mean something like "well done"?
Or it is referring to a "well done try" implying that it was just a try?

It can just be the latter; that you say that somebody tried and that he or she did well.
But it's used more often sarcastically: when somebody does or tries something and fails at it, you will make fun of them by saying "nice try" (usually implying you could do it better than that).
